About agriculture in Kambos

Kambos is situated in the South Aegean region of Greece, nestled within a fertile coastal plain characteristic of the Dodecanese islands. The surrounding landscape features a mix of rugged hills and verdant valleys that stretch toward the Aegean Sea. The rural area is dotted with small-scale traditional farms and stone-walled plots, benefiting from the Mediterranean climate and refreshing sea breezes.

Agriculture in this part of Greece is dominated by olive groves and citrus orchards, which thrive in the sun-drenched environment. Local farmers also cultivate vineyards and seasonal vegetables, often utilizing greenhouses to extend the growing season and protect crops from coastal winds. Small livestock farming, primarily goats and sheep, is common in the more mountainous fringes surrounding the plain, contributing to the region's dairy production.

For agronomists and farm workers, Kambos offers seasonal opportunities during the olive harvest in late autumn and the citrus picking season in winter. There is also steady demand for labor in vegetable cultivation and greenhouse maintenance throughout the year. Professionals coming to the area can expect a traditional Greek island work environment where local knowledge of arid-land farming and efficient irrigation management is highly valued.
